HC to hear Shahidul's bail petition today
The High Court is set to hear the bail petition of internationally-acclaimed photographer Shahidul Alam today, in the case filed against him under section 57 of ICT Act.
The bench of Justice Sheikh Abdul Awal and Justice Bhishmadev Chakrabortty fixed the date yesterday after Assistant Attorney General Mohammad Ali Jinnah sought time for the hearing.
He told the court that Attorney General Mahbubey Alam, who was scheduled to place argument on the petition, was sick.
Meanwhile, Shahidul's lawyer Barrister Sara Hossain yesterday prayed to the court to continue the hearing.
On November 1, the bench of Justice AKM Asaduzzaman and Justice SM Mozibur Rahman dropped the same petition from their hearing list.
Following this, Shahidul placed the petition before the bench led by Justice Sheikh Abdul Awal.
Shahidul Alam filed the petition with HC on September 18, after he was sued under Section 57 of ICT Act for “spreading propaganda against the government”.
He was picked up from his home on August 5.
